Elegoo's Spectacular Showcase at IFA 2025: Revolutionizing 3D Printing with Centauri Carbon

Elegoo's Impactful Appearance at IFA 2025



Elegoo's recent participation in IFA 2025 has been nothing short of groundbreaking, marking a significant moment in the evolution of 3D printing technology. The company introduced its latest innovation, the Centauri Carbon 3D printer, which garnered not just one but seven prestigious 'Best of IFA' awards along with the coveted IFA Innovation Award. This recognition underscores Elegoo's commitment to producing cutting-edge, consumer-friendly technology that bridges the gap between professional-grade performance and household accessibility.

The Centauri Carbon printer has been commended by renowned tech platforms such as Tom's Hardware, Reviewed, and Gadgety. These accolades emphasize Elegoo's dedication to design excellence and its capability to make high-performance 3D printing available to everyday consumers. At IFA, Elegoo's booth was a highlight, showcasing an immersive experience that featured a 3D-printed living room fully furnished with sofas, tables, and décor — all crafted using its state-of-the-art printers.

Attendees were enthralled by a variety of colorful 3D-printed applications that exemplified how the technology can innovate everyday life. Among these attractions was the Butterfly Chair, designed by German designer Philippe Bietenholz and fabricated with the OrangeStorm Giga printer. This piece quickly became a favorite among visitors who applauded the design, contributing to what many described as the best booth design of the show.

Elegoo's display attracted a diverse audience, ranging from hobbyists and educators interested in new engineering teaching tools to first-time users eager to explore the potential of 3D printing. The booth drew considerable attention from content creators as well, who expressed interest in collaboration to widen Elegoo's reach in the creative community. Notably, younger attendees showed strong enthusiasm for the technology, already integrating it into personal projects, signaling a robust future for 3D printing.

About Elegoo


Founded in 2015, Elegoo has rapidly established itself within the global smart manufacturing sector, focusing on the research, development, and sale of consumer-grade 3D printers, laser engravers, STEM kits, and various smart technology products. Based in Shenzhen, often dubbed the Silicon Valley of China, the company has achieved impressive milestones, selling millions of products across over 100 countries and regions. In 2024, Elegoo reported total sales revenue exceeding 220 million USD, employing more than 1,000 people and managing a manufacturing area of nearly 30,000 square meters. With a strong emphasis on programming and 3D printing technology, Elegoo continues to innovate, creating unique and intelligent spaces to enhance consumer experiences.
